Microsoft sign-in for your app is Lovable's Security feature: Your app's users can now sign in with their Microsoft account , alongside Google and Apple.
Your app's users can now sign in with their Microsoft account , alongside Google and Apple. In your project, open Cloud → Users → Auth settings , select Microsoft under Sign in methods , and turn on Enable Microsoft sign-in , or ask Lovable to add Microsoft sign-in to your app. Lovable manages the OAuth credentials by default, so no Azure setup is needed. Switch to Your own credentials to use your own Azure app registration, show your own app name on the consent screen, and limit sign-in to your organization. Microsoft sign-in is part of the built-in authentication for apps on Lovable Cloud.
